Adroitness

Adroitness noun - Mental skill or quickness.
Usage example: shows a remarkable adroitness in identifying birds the moment they land at the feeder

Capacity

Capacity noun - The physical or mental power to do something.
Usage example: not everyone has the capacity for learning higher math
